THE 15TH CAIRO International Festival for Experimental Theatre ended last Thursday amid the usual flurry and excitement of awards. This year's international jury -- responsible for the nominations and final selection -- was headed by Brian Singleton (Ireland) and comprised Ana Rosa Barrionuevo (Argentina), Anatoly Vassiliev (Russia), Freddy Decreus (Belgium), Ilse Scheer (Germany), Jean Randich (USA), Jean-Michel Meunier (France), Michel Vais (Canada), Nehad Selaiha (Egypt), Salvatore Bitoni (Italy) and Younis Louelidi (Morocco).

The nominees and winners of the Jury Awards were:

Best Ensemble Work , nominees: Osiris Coverage (Hungary), Torrance and Grady (Switzerland), Presentiment (Republic of Yakutia, Russia). Winner: Masks, Fabrics and Destinies (Egypt), jointly with Hamlet... If There Is Time (Sweden).

Best Production, nominees: Hamlet... If There Is Time (Sweden), Masks, Fabrics and Destinies (Egypt) and Osiris Coverage (Hungary). Winner: Karma (South Korea)

Best Director, nominees: Ibrahim Khalfan (Bahrain) for An Ideal Day, Jungung Yang (South Korea) for Karma, Lukas Bangerter (Switzerland) for Torrance and Grady. Winner: Gabor Goda (Hungary) for Osiris Coverage.

Best Actress, nominees: Chang Ai Li and Kim Ji Sung (South Korea) for Karma, and Anna Alifonotova (Russia) for Nina Variations. Winner: Josephine Andersson (Sweden) for Hamlet...If There Is Time.

Best Actor, nominees: Phillipe Nauer (Switzerland) for Torrance and Grady, and Fedor Ivov (Russia) for Nina Variations. Winner: Helal Antar (Algeria) for Poems of Wonder.

Best Scenography, nominees: Karma (South Korea), Masks, Fabrics and Destinies (Egypt), Osiris Coverage (Hungary) and Torrance and Grady (Switzerland). Winner: Walid Aouni for A Sculptor's Dream (Egypt, original name, Mahmoud Mokhtar and the Khamaseen Wind).
